The Milpitas Police Department (MPD) on Wednesday released information about a newly begun “death investigation”…
Yesterday, December 17, MPD officers were dispatched to the Turing Apartments (1355 McCandless Drive) to carry out a welfare check.
When the officers went inside the apartment, they found the bodies of a man, a woman, and two children, all exhibiting “signs of death,” according to an MPD press release.
The release went on to call this an “isolated incident,” and state that there is no widespread danger to the public. MPD detectives have started an investigation.
No further information has been made available to the public at this time, but The Milpitas Beat will follow the story as it unfolds.
